3. Verify that the following LEDs on the front of the router light up:
Power. Power is supplied to the router.
LAN. Your computer is securely connected to this LAN port on the router.
USB. Your wireless USB modem is securely connected to the router.
Wireless. There is a wireless signal from the router.
Internet. This LED is red because the router is not connected to the Internet.
Using the Setup Wizard
The NETGEAR Setup Wizard helps you to configure your Internet connection and wireless
network. The Setup Wizard guides you through the setup process. You can also manually
configure your router (see “Accessing the Setup Wizard after Installation” on page 1-11).
Using the Setup Wizard to Configure Your Router’s Internet
Connection
1. From the Ethernet connected computer, open a Web browser.
2. Connect to the router by typing http://192.168.0.1 or www.routerlogin.com in the address
field of your browser. The Setup screen displays:
Figure 1-8
Note: If you connect to the router after initial configuration, a log in prompt displays.
See “Logging in to the Router after Installation” on page 1-10”.
